Merge branch 'nvme-4.20' of git://git.infradead.org/nvme into for-4.20/block
Pull NVMe updates from Christoph: "A relatively boring merge window: - better AEN tracing (Chaitanya) - NUMA aware PCIe multipathing (me) - RDMA workqueue fixes (Sagi) - better bio usage in the target (Sagi) - FC rework for target removal (James) - better multipath handling of ->queue_rq failures (James) - various cleanups (Milan)" * 'nvme-4.20' of git://git.infradead.org/nvme: nvmet-rdma: use a private workqueue for delete nvme: take node locality into account when selecting a path nvmet: don't split large I/Os unconditionally nvme: call nvme_complete_rq when nvmf_check_ready fails for mpath I/O nvme-core: add async event trace helper nvme_fc: add 'nvme_discovery' sysfs attribute to fc transport device nvmet_fc: support target port removal with nvmet layer nvme-fc: fix for a minor typos nvmet: remove redundant module prefix nvme: fix typo in nvme_identify_ns_descs
